Dr. Sultan Al Jaber Calls for Unified Action to Implement UAE Consensus at MoCA

At the eighth Ministerial on Climate Action (MoCA), held on Monday, COP28 President Dr. Sultan Al Jaber emphasized the critical role of solidarity in implementing the landmark UAE Consensus. Addressing ministers in Wuhan, China, Dr. Al Jaber underscored that the collaborative spirit which led to the consensus must now drive its execution to advance sustainable socio-economic development.

The UAE Consensus, established at COP28 in Dubai last December, has become a pivotal reference for global climate goals and sustainable development. Dr. Al Jaber highlighted that this historic agreement was achieved through inclusivity and collaboration, principles that continue to yield tangible results on the ground.

In a significant move, PetroChina, responsible for 3.5% of global oil production, has joined the Oil and Gas Decarbonisation Charter (OGDC). Launched at COP28, the OGDC aims to accelerate the sector's decarbonization by calling for net-zero emissions by 2050, eliminating routine flaring and methane emissions by 2030, and investing in future energy systems. PetroChina's inclusion, alongside 52 other companies representing 40% of global oil production, signifies a notable boost in commitment, particularly with National Oil Companies making up over 60% of the signatories.

Dr. Al Jaber praised PetroChina's decision as a momentous step for Chinese leadership, urging other global companies to follow suit and align with the principles of the OGDC. This move sends a powerful message to companies yet to commit, emphasizing the importance of choosing the right side of history.

The COP28 President also called on nations to submit comprehensive Nationally Determined Contributions (NDCs) that address all aspects of climate action, from decarbonization to deforestation. He stressed the need for these plans to be actionable, balancing mitigation, adaptation, and implementation.

Dr. Al Jaber highlighted the crucial role of the COP Presidencies Troika—comprising COP28, Azerbaijan, and Brazil—in maintaining political momentum for climate action. He urged all sectors to adopt climate resilience as a guiding principle, recommending strategies that future-proof business models while prioritizing people and the planet.

He reiterated the importance of boosting investments in carbon-free energies, setting an ambitious goal of tripling renewable energy capacity this decade. Dr. Al Jaber pointed to a recent IRENA report noting the need for a 16.4% annual growth in renewable capacity through 2030, emphasizing that history shows humanity's ability to surpass expectations.

China’s significant contribution to global solar capacity and solar panel production was acknowledged, with Dr. Al Jaber commending China as a renewable energy powerhouse and encouraging others to emulate its success.

Regarding Artificial Intelligence (AI), Dr. Al Jaber noted its potential to influence energy and transport sectors but cautioned about the increased energy demand AI will generate. He called for smart approaches to meet this demand while leveraging AI's benefits.

The COP28 President also advocated for scaling up nuclear energy, expediting renewable energy project permits, modernizing grid infrastructure, and recognizing natural gas's transitional role in providing energy access. He reiterated the need for reform in the international financial framework to make climate finance more accessible and affordable, urging private-sector investment to play a crucial role.

Dr. Al Jaber highlighted ALTÉRRA, the world's largest private investment vehicle for climate change action, launched at COP28 with a $30 billion commitment from the UAE, as a key player in changing the climate finance dynamic.

In conclusion, Dr. Al Jaber encouraged parties to take inspiration from the UAE Consensus to set even higher goals through their NDCs, leading to concrete actions. This week at MoCA, the COP Presidencies Troika will host a Majlis—a traditional Emirati meeting—focused on forest conservation and the synergy between biodiversity and climate. This session is part of the Action and Ambition Majlis Series, launched earlier this year to elevate ambition for the next round of NDCs.
